We're moving forward!  A couple weeks ago I gave a presentation to the Hermosa Beach City Council asking for their support for our vision of a wetland/park at the AES power plant site, if we can find a way to incentivize them to sell.  Well, as you can imagine, they're all for it!
 
So, this Tuesday, July 24th, 2007 at 7 p.m., the Hermosa Beach City Council is going to pass a resolution of support for our efforts, and ask that the other government officials in this area assist the State Coastal Conservancy and others in creating the waterfront park this area so desperately needs.  Here is a link to Tuesday's agenda.  Go to item 2.n. and click on the background material to read what it says.
 
http://www.hermosabch.org/departments/cityclerk/agenmin/cca20070724/
 
Let it be known Hermosa Beach is the first city in the South Bay to pass a resolution supporting the results of the 2005 Redondo Beach advisory vote.  They deserve the appreciation of the entire South Bay!
